Claire Ellen Landry, 82, of Florence, Wis. entered into eternal life on Thursday, June 11, 2009, at Dickinson County Healthcare System in Iron Mountain surrounded by family.
She was born June 13, 1926, in Florence, Wis., daughter of the late William and Gertrude (Kenney) Witynski. Claire graduated from Florence High School, Class of 1944. She then graduated from St. Mary's School of Nursing, Green Bay, Wis. in 1947. Claire married the true love of her life, Robert "Bob" Francis Landry on May 7, 1949. They lived together in Green Bay before moving to Florence in 1957. Bob preceded her in death in 1978.
Claire was employed at St. Mary's until later moving back to Florence. While living in Florence, Claire worked at the Florence Lakeview Convalescent Home, the Florence Medical Center, and the Florence Villa in Florence serving as the Director of Nurses and a Registeres Nurse until the age of 76.
She was an active member of St. Mary Catholic Church, Belles of St. Mary's, St. Mary's Nursing Alumni, and Cursillo. Claire cherished and was devoted to her family, her faith, and her work. She will be forever remembered as the unsung hero working behind the scenes, inspiring many with her kind, caring and unselfish actions.
